Biography
Stelios Mainas is a Greek actor.
He was born in Ermoupoli, Syros on October 1, 1957 and grew up in Athens. He studied Business Administration (hotel studies) and later graduated from the Veaki Drama School in 1984. In later years, he worked as an actor in many of the central and regional Theaters of Athens and the province. He became more widely known with his participation in the television series Oi men and the ones who don't" and the movie Balkanizer. In 2015 he won the best actor award at the Hellenic Film Academy Awards for his role in the film Wednesday 04:45.
